**Action item (PM-7):** The Ladlefox recipe scaler blew up on fractional yields because rounding thresholds were hardcoded in three places. Consolidate them into one constants block and add a unit test per threshold. Future maintainers: don't "just tweak one" — they interact. Until the refactor lands, the agreed canonical values are these.

constants for bawif-kawif:
QUOTAS = {
    "ulaael": 5,
    "holael": 10,
}

## Authentication

The Tallyfern loyalty-points ledger requires authenticated requests for every read and write; unauthenticated calls are rejected before reaching the ledger core. For the demo during this week's eng sync, staging accepts a pre-provisioned credential so nobody needs to mint their own. Use the bearer token provided below.

session JWT of yawep-yawep = eyJhbGciOiJIUzI1NiIsInR5cCI6IkpXVCJ9.eyJzdWIiOiI3pWF3_In0.aXYsHiog

This page covers movement of the grey locked case containing Pallister T-4 test devices between the Wrenfield lab and field sites. The case must never be opened in transit; only authorised staff hold keys. Before each trip, records team members verify the tamper seal, photograph the case, and log the seal number in the transport register. On arrival, the receiving officer repeats these checks and countersigns. The confidential instruction governing the courier hand-over is recorded immediately below this section.

dispatch memo: the sorox briiel courier leaves the druius kelion fenir gorvan ralael rusius julwyn belwyn ledger at gate 4220 under passcode 637242